british citizenship(3points on license)

Post by wiseguy4shani » Thu Nov 04, 2010 2:19 pm

hi every1,i wonder if any1 can help me,i am due for my british citizenship on marriage basis,i qualify for everything apart from i got 3 points on my license since november 2006 which are expired now and was for jumping the lights"TS10",i rang the UKBA and asked them if i need to write them on the application and they said if that case is bn to court then u have to and you cant apply till 2011 november cause the time period is 5years,now the thing is i dont remember if that case is bn to court or its bn to FPO cause i plead guilty i never bn to court bt i did write a letter to sum1 and ask them if they dont fine me cause i was a student at that time and then they asked me to pay £35/- fine and i ll get 3 points,i was happy with that now i m abit worried,cause i th8 its a minor offence and it wont affect my application,can any1 help me with that plz thanks

Post by mrlookforward » Tue Nov 09, 2010 2:15 pm

I think you are getting the wrong idea by the words "been to court". It doesn't matter if you go to court physically, or enter a plea by post. If the case was decided by a court, then it is a conviction and attracts 5 years rehabilitation period.
